Output 100dab6e7bfbdf8752c81b3c9593fd088906fd383c0f98f2ea664b19bbd8d12f:0

value
332760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 959133d8bed3e9444844f42113815b73fa28578d OP_EQUAL
address
3FKrYyVhHBx1QnbHMasGyboKBSTCKK43Qe
transaction
100dab6e7bfbdf8752c81b3c9593fd088906fd383c0f98f2ea664b19bbd8d12f
confirmations
388842
spent
true